Only 1/3 space requirement compared to a horizontal grinding system
A Polymer concrete machine base absorbs vibration and, due to low heat conductivity, eliminates expansion while maximizing precision
Direct drive spindle (without belts) with pre-loaded bearings eliminates any vibrations
Improved quality due to high precision linear motion guides
The vertical design offers an optimum flow of coolant and grinding swarf
Stainless enclosure within the grinding area
Sensing system for grinding wheel wear compensation with no mechanical moving parts
Reduced idle times due to rapid traverse speeds up to 60 m/min in the grinding axis and extremely short workpiece change times
Low set-up time due to rapid clamping systems, easy grinding wheel change and advanced software technology

The part supports (clamping rails) must be adapted to each workpiece according to its size and shape.
The workpieces are fixed on the clamping rail by a pneumatically actuated clamping finger.
